Quote:
Basically the hydraulic circuit goes as follows. Main tanden master cylinder > ABS valve block > rear proportioning valve > handbrake master cylinder > rear caliprs. The main master cylinder is a GDB STi item. (Larger bore than SG Forester) I have totoally removed and bypassed the hill holder, which used to be inbetween the main master and the ABS. In its place is a hardline i bent up to totoally remove it from the system. The proportioning valve is also a GDB item. (Unsure if different to SG Forester, but suspect it is due to different brakes on both vehicles.) Front brakes are Wilwood FNSL6R calipers. Rear brakes are GDB STi Brembos. (Overhauled and painted before fitting) Handbrake master cylinder is a Group N STi / AP Racing inline tandem with 7/10 inch bore. (Freshly overhauled before fitting.) [

Quote:
What size / compound tyres you running because I imagine a 235 or 245 semi-slick would possibly outgrip the clamping pressure of your rear Brembos in a straight line situation. A simple (not cheap) solution is to, as you suggested, go to a larger rear brake set-up. Once you have the car turning in then you can use the handbrake and vehicle inertia to overwhelm the tyres a lot easier.
